
Local pumpkin today!! Our pumpkins grow to approximately 30 lb, with a dark green skin; inside you’ll find sweet orange flesh that is versatile in stews, purées, stuffing, pies, curries, soups, custard, or simply roasted. You can even slice it super thin raw and use it like a potato chip in hummus. Our personal favorite is a pumpkin-coconut soup, with a dash of ginger. Add a dollop of beet purée into the cheery orange soup for a swirl of amazing color!
